Welcome to Gunter

Gunter, TX Homes For Sale

Gunter, Texas, is a welcoming and steadily growing community in Grayson County that I often recommend to my clients. With a population of just over 2,300, it offers the comfort of a small-town atmosphere while still providing convenient access to the Dallas–Fort Worth metroplex. I find that families are especially drawn to the highly regarded Gunter ISD, known for its strong academic performance and supportive environment. Many of my buyers also appreciate the opportunity to purchase homes on one-acre lots, which provide ample space, privacy, and a true sense of country living.

Gunter Homes Sales Data - September 2025

The Gunter real estate market in September 2025 slowed notably, giving buyers more breathing room and negotiation power. The average home sold for $816,722 after spending about 82 days on the market, closing at 94.7% of the original list price. With a generous 11.4 months of supply and 62 active listings, inventory levels are high compared to surrounding areas. Homes averaged $219 per square foot, offering solid value for buyers seeking space and quality construction. While new and pending sales were limited, Gunter continues to attract those looking for acreage, peace, and small-town charm within reach of North Dallas.

Where Is Gunter, TX?

Gunter, TX, is a charming small town located in Grayson County, just north of Prosper and west of Celina. Known for its peaceful rural setting, friendly community, and wide-open spaces, Gunter offers a slower pace of life while still being within reach of major highways for an easy commute. The primary zip code for Gunter is 75058. Situated in North Texas, Gunter’s geo coordinates are approximately 33°26′53″N 96°44′53″W.
